Just watched the final hour of day 5 England vs India
England needed just 35 runs
India needed 4 wickets
First 2 balls of day went for 4 Only 27 needed
Then 4 wickets India win by 6 runs
England were at one point 3-301 chasing 374
All out 367 that's 7-66
Series tied 2-2

Following England 2-2 drawn series with India .The total focus of the Poms now is the Ashes .Nothing matters more to them than regaining the Ashes
They have a few batsmen in serious form
Crawley ,Duckett , Root , Brook now what do we have ?
We thrashed the Windies 3-0 but looking at our batting in most recent test vs more serious opposition ie South Africa in June
That test Kwajaja ave 3.0 Labuschagne ave 19.5 Green ave 2.0 Smith ave 39.5
Head ave 10.0 Webster 40.5 Carey ave 33.0 Starc 59.0 Cummins 4.0
Lyon 1.0 Hazelwood 17.0
Only Smith ,Webster ,Starc and Carey got satisfactory averages
Big concern is our top 3
Needs serious attention before Nov

Well despite a bunch of our batters failing in game 1vs Sth Africa we still have a fairly comfortable win .This makes 9 in a row for Australia
Head looked out of touch .Inglis out first ball , Maxxy out for 2 ,Owen failed but
Marsh his usual 16 off 8 balls so we got a reasonable score 178 thanks to our T20 star Tim David 83 and a good knock 35 from Green .Dwarshuis also played an important role given we were 7 down in less than 9 overs .
With the ball Hazo was magic ,Maxxy bowled well and took another of his
"All time great catches "
This is a game where you must hit 6's and we hit 13 ( 8 by Tim David )
The Sth Africans could only manage 2 or 3
Australia 10/178 ( 20 overs ) Sth Africa 9/161 ( 20 overs )
